Phenomenal Spotlight: Multilingual Learner Summit 01.07.2022

In the third edition of Phenomenal Spotlight, we discussed the backgrounds each guest(Dr. Carol Salva, Dr. Katie Toppel, and Tan Huynh), starting the ML Book Club, what a Multilingual Learner, adding more diversity to the teaching profession, and Multilingual Learner Summit.  Dr. Carol Salva is an educational consultant at Seidlitz Education. She's an award winning educator with a track recor...

Phenomenal Spotlight: Dr. Pam Kastner And The Science of Reading 17.06.2022

In the very first "Phenomenal Spotlight", I interviewed Dr. Pam Kastner, an Education Consultant at PaTTAN(Pennsylvania Training and Technical Assistance Network), where she serves as the State Lead for Literacy. She's also the President of Pennsylvania's Reading League. We discussed her start in education, PaTTAN and most importantly--The Science of Reading. Be Phenomenal, Mr. Short Science of Re...
